Danny Keith Daniels, 68, of Pearl, Mississippi, passed away on June 13, 2026, in Pearl, Mississippi.

Danny was born on March 22, 1958, in Philadelphia, Mississippi, to Marlyn Cecil Daniels and Bobbie Parker Daniels.

Danny retired from the Mississippi Department of Transportation after more than 18 years of dedicated service. He enjoyed football and was a devoted fan of the New Orleans Saints, as well as fantasy football, NASCAR, spending time with family and friends, and playing darts. Danny was a longtime member of the Greater Jackson Dart Association and played league darts for many years until his health no longer allowed him to continue.

Danny also enjoyed creating personalized signs and custom gifts for his family and friends, something he took great pride in sharing with those he loved. He also had a special love for Hot Wheels and Ford Mustangs, passions that brought him joy and reflected his fun-loving spirit. These hobbies and interests were just a few of the many ways Danny expressed his creativity and generosity, leaving lasting memories with everyone who knew him.

Danny is survived by his sister, Marsha Daniels of Richmond, Virginia; as well as David and Rachel Castle of Hazlehurst, Mississippi, and their children, Brooke Castle Davis (Hunter) of Madison, Mississippi; David Bradley Castle of Hazlehurst, Mississippi; Kameron Castle Boyles (Brian) of Puckett, Mississippi; and Seth Castle of Hazlehurst, Mississippi, who he considered family after more than 30 years of friendship and love.

He was preceded in death by his parents, Bobbie Parker Daniels and Marlyn Cecil Daniels; his stepmother, Virginia Daniels; his maternal grandparents, J.D. and Louise Parker; and his paternal grandparents, Johnny Ben and Bonnie Daniels.

Danny will be remembered for his creativity, his love of sports, his loyal friendships, and the time he spent with those closest to him.

McClain-Hays Funeral Service is handling arrangements. The family will hold a private service with burial at Spring Creek Baptist Church Cemetery.
